Graduation Gift Etiquette Tips

I think there’s confusion among people about graduation as this is not an occasion with a “Tag”. Like “Is it normal to give a graduation gift?”, “How much money is appropriate for a graduation gift?”, or “Is cash ok to give?”. Some basic considerations are-

➢ It’s perfectly normal to give a graduation gift.

➢ The thought matters more than the price tag.

➢ Cash is always appreciated, but personalized gifts are memorable.

➢ Consider the graduate’s interests and future plans.

➢ If giving money, $50-$200 is a typical range for high school, while college graduations might see higher amounts.

➢ Think about the depth of relation you have with the giftee that will make the decisions easier.
